The plug types are different between these two countries. In Papua New Guinea, outlets accept Type I, but in Ethiopia you'll find Type C/F sockets. A travel plug adapter is essential for this trip.
On the voltage front, Papua New Guinea (240V, 50Hz) and Ethiopia (220V, 50Hz) are very similar. You shouldn't need a voltage converter for your electronics.
Don't forget that Ethiopia hotel rooms sometimes have a universal shaver socket in the bathroom, but these low-wattage outlets aren't suitable for high-draw devices. For reliable charging, use the standard wall outlets with a proper adapter.
